About Driving BMW: Drift, Tuning, and Realistic Car Destruction
Driving BMW drops you into a world of drift and tuning where the goal is to build an exclusive car and push it hard on the track. The game centers on BMW drifting with a deep set of customization options and a realistic car destruction system that makes every crash feel consequential.
Tuning goes well beyond a fresh coat of paint. Wheels, body color, interior color, suspension settings, ride height, numbers, flags, and stickers are all adjustable, letting you shape both the performance character and the visual personality of your car. The suspension can be tuned for better cross-country ability, and lowering the ride height gives the car a more aggressive stance.
The destruction model is a headline feature: body parts break away, windows crack, and headlights shatter as damage accumulates, making the racing feel authentic. Beyond drifting and crashing, catapults are part of the action — hit one and the car goes airborne.
How to Play Driving BMW
The core loop is straightforward: get behind the wheel, tune your BMW to your liking, then drift, destroy, and fly off catapults. Adjust the wheels, paint, interior, suspension, and ride height before heading out, and add numbers, flags, or stickers to finish the look. Once on track, the realistic destruction system means broken body parts, cracked windows, and shattered headlights accumulate as you race and crash.
Controls
- WASD or Arrow Keys: Driving controls
- Space: Handbrake
- C: Change camera view
- F: Acceleration
- Start button: Activate the catapult
